Odarpur is a village in Fatehpur Tehsil of Bara Banki district in Uttar Pradesh. Its Census location code is 163897.

About Odarpur village record

The source record places Odarpur in Fatehpur Tehsil of Bara Banki district, Uttar Pradesh. Its Census village code is 163897.

The Census 2011 record reports population 1,680, 317 households, area 237.83 hectares.
